Apply one test to every number proposed for a website measurement plan: if no named person would choose differently when it changes, it does not belong on the plan’s decision layer. That does not make the number useless; it may still support exploration or diagnosis. It does mean the organization should stop treating a crowded dashboard as a measurement strategy. A decision record gives website owners and analysts a tighter unit of work: one owner, one pending choice, one intended user outcome, one answerable question, a compact evidence family, explicit limitations, and a scheduled review.

Which decision should the measurement plan support?
The plan should support a choice that a named owner must make by a defined review point. Write it as a decision among real alternatives: fund a redesign, make a smaller intervention, continue gathering evidence, or leave the journey unchanged. Add the owner, decision date, resources at stake, and the evidence that could alter the choice. Evaluation guidance emphasizes answering the right question in time for a key decision, while performance-measurement guidance treats decision support as a core reason to collect and elevate information.
Record the response that meaningful movement could prompt: reallocate funding, investigate a journey step, revise content, commission research, or preserve the current experience. This discipline separates operational measurement from exploratory analysis, where the purpose may be discovery and no action is predetermined. A metric need not produce an immediate change every time it moves, but its role in a future choice, investigation, resource allocation, or risk review must be clear before it receives ceremonial prominence.
What user outcome and question make the decision measurable?
Start with the change users should experience, then turn it into a bounded question that can inform the pending choice. “Qualified evaluators can distinguish the options and choose an appropriate next step with less uncertainty” is an outcome; “increase engagement” is too vague to guide evidence design. Define the journey, relevant users, alternatives under consideration, comparison basis, and decision timing. Then state which observations would make the intended outcome more or less plausible without treating any single signal as the outcome itself.
Choose collection methods only after the question is stable. Web analytics may show where sessions exit, but usability research can reveal whether people understand an option, feedback can expose recurring language, support records can identify unresolved questions, and operational or financial evidence can show downstream consequences. Evaluation guidance supports matching methods to questions and using more than one method when needed. Keep the mix proportionate to the decision’s cost, urgency, available traffic, and risk; more data is not automatically better evidence.
Which indicators belong in a compact evidence family?
Keep indicators that perform one of four explicit roles: represent the intended outcome, help diagnose movement, guard against unacceptable deterioration, or test whether the evidence is trustworthy. This family adapts distinctions used in controlled-experiment analysis without pretending that a general website dashboard is an experiment. The outcome indicator may be direct task evidence or a qualified proxy. Diagnostics locate friction or suggest explanations. Guardrails expose tradeoffs elsewhere. Data-quality indicators show whether coverage, classification, or processing is sound enough for interpretation.
Outcome: evidence closest to the user or business result under consideration, with proxy status stated plainly.
Diagnostic: evidence that helps locate or explain movement without being presented as causal proof.
Guardrail: evidence of deterioration the team wants to detect before choosing an intervention.
Data quality: evidence that collection, classification, coverage, and processing are trustworthy enough to use.
Resist collapsing the family into one topline score. General performance guidance recommends balancing strategic and operational views, including process, output, outcome, leading, and lagging measures. The practical implication is not to collect every category; it is to preserve the distinctions the decision requires. An easily moved metric earns no place merely because the analytics platform exposes it. Every retained indicator should answer a stated interpretive question and have an owner who knows what its movement can and cannot mean.
A metric earns its place by changing a decision, explaining uncertainty, guarding against harm, or testing whether the evidence can be trusted.
Which segments could lead to a different action?
Include a segment when a credible difference could lead to a different content, journey, accessibility, or investment response and when the underlying data can support that comparison. If the team would make the same choice regardless of the result, keep the dimension exploratory. For each proposed segment, write the distinct action it could trigger, the comparison required, and the minimum practical evidence conditions. This tests decision relevance and feasibility without inventing a universal statistical threshold.
Check classification coverage, sparse values, cardinality, unknown values, and the behavior of the intended reporting surface before promising the comparison. In GA4, for example, reports, explorations, APIs, and exports can differ in aggregation, sampling, modeling, row limits, and detail. High-cardinality dimensions may also reduce interpretability. Those are product-specific cautions, not universal platform rules. Do not collect identity, demographic, or behavioral attributes simply because a tool exposes them; collection needs a defined purpose, justified necessity, and appropriate governance.
What must the data contract specify before collection begins?
The data contract must make each indicator reproducible, governable, and interpretable before results arrive. Record its operational definition, numerator and denominator when relevant, source, collection method, unit or grain, inclusion and exclusion rules, owner, quality check, expected latency, comparison basis, and known limitations. Also state what the indicator cannot reveal and which qualitative or operational evidence is still needed. Documenting questions, methods, comparisons, assumptions, and limitations in advance helps stakeholders judge whether the design can credibly support the decision.
Definition: the event, task result, rate, count, or theme represented and the rules used to calculate it.
Collection: the source, exact reporting surface, method, grain, coverage conditions, and responsible owner.
Limits: sampling, aggregation, modeling, attribution, missing coverage, proxy status, and questions the evidence cannot answer.
Name the reporting surface rather than writing only a metric label. GA4 reports, explorations, the Data API, and BigQuery can expose different combinations of aggregate or event-level data, modeling, sampling, attribution, limits, and exports. Where personal data is involved, document why it is necessary and involve the appropriate privacy or legal owner. UK guidance illustrates principles such as specified purpose, data minimization, accuracy, storage limitation, security, and accountability, but obligations for a U.S. organization depend on its jurisdiction and circumstances; the measurement plan is not a compliance determination.
When should evidence trigger review rather than an automatic verdict?
Review evidence when the decision is due and the underlying process and outcome have had time to change, not merely when a dashboard refreshes. A release-quality check may happen quickly, while an outcome dependent on a longer journey may mature later. Performance guidance connects measurement cycle time to process cycle time, and planning guidance places ownership, review frequency, benchmarks, analysis, iteration, and refinement inside the plan. No universal daily, weekly, or monthly cadence applies across website decisions.
Unless an automatic rule has been deliberately validated, treat a threshold or benchmark as a prompt for investigation and discussion rather than a verdict. A negative signal can point toward the wrong fix when the underlying problem remains unknown. At each review, record the decision, evidence considered, unresolved uncertainty, chosen action, owner, and next review point. Revise or retire measures that no longer distinguish performance or inform action. When a definition changes, mark the break so readers do not mistake discontinuous data for one continuous trend.
How does a decision record work in a real website planning case?
A decision record turns mixed evidence into a bounded choice by keeping the owner, alternatives, outcome, question, indicators, limits, and review action together. Consider a hypothetical B2B software company deciding at its next quarterly planning review whether to fund a comparison-path redesign, make a smaller content intervention, or leave the path unchanged. The website owner and product marketing lead want qualified evaluators to identify the option that fits their situation and reach an appropriate next step with less uncertainty. Their question asks where option distinctions fail, for whom, and whether a targeted intervention is justified.
Moderated comparison-task success supplies outcome evidence, supplemented by the proportion of qualified comparison-path sessions reaching an appropriate next step. Misunderstanding themes, exits by step, and option-related support questions remain diagnostics rather than causal proof. Qualified lead rate and accessibility task success act as guardrails, with their comparison basis and review triggers defined in advance. Classification coverage, consent-aware event coverage, and unknown or other values test data quality. Entry intent and account complexity become operational segments only if different results would lead to different interventions.

Periodic usability benchmarking can assess task completion across representative tasks, while analytics and other records add broader but qualified signals. End the review with six questions: What decision is due? What evidence changed? What remains uncertain? What action follows? Who owns it? What should stop being collected? Bring in analytics, research, accessibility, data-governance, platform, privacy, or legal specialists when the evidence design or jurisdiction-specific obligations exceed the team’s competence.
Website measurement plan FAQ
What is a website measurement plan?
A website measurement plan is a set of decision records connecting named owners and choices to user outcomes, bounded questions, indicators, data requirements, limitations, and review actions. It explains not only what will be measured, but why the evidence matters, how trustworthy it is, and what decision it can inform.
How do you create a web analytics measurement plan?
Name the decision, owner, alternatives, and timing first. Then define the user outcome, frame the question, assign indicator roles, select only actionable and feasible segments, specify the data contract, document limitations, and schedule the review. Choose tools and collection methods after the question is clear.
How should a business choose website metrics?
Choose each metric for an explicit outcome, diagnostic, guardrail, or data-quality role. Reject metrics that are included only because a platform makes them available or because they look impressive on a dashboard. State whether an outcome measure is direct evidence or a qualified proxy, and do not treat observational movement as proof of causation.
What should a website KPI framework include?
Include decision ownership, indicator definitions, feasible sources, relevant segments, calculation rules, quality checks, latency, comparison bases, privacy constraints, interpretation limits, and review triggers. The framework should also identify who acts, what gets recorded, and when a measure should be revised or retired. It should not rely on unexplained universal targets.
How often should website metrics be reviewed?
Review cadence should follow the timing of the pending decision, the speed of the underlying process, the latency of the intended outcome, and the availability of credible data. A dashboard’s refresh rate does not determine when evidence is mature enough to use. There is no universal daily, weekly, or monthly frequency for every website measure.
